Community Over Code Europe
Hello all, I am happy to announce that the Apache Cloudstack Community has an approved track during the Community over Code Europe (formerly known as ApacheCon EU), which will be held at the Radisson Blu Carlton Hotel in Bratislava, Slovakia from June 03-05, 2024! Community Over Code is where you will learn about the latest innovations from Apache Software Foundation (ASF) projects and their communities in a collaborative, vendor-neutral environment. This year, Community Over Code will take place at the charming city of Bratislava in Slovakia where open source communities from all over the world will have an opportunity for free-form discussion and planning around our various projects.
